Woodmen of the World monument for Wilson Weaver -- Findagrave says "William Wilson Weaver" -- in historic Carter Cemetery, south of Canton, TX.

The family name, "Weaver", is on the plinth, and above it, an epitaph: "How desolate our home, bereft of thee." Above is the common scroll on a rope, with the Woodmen emblem and:

Wilson Weaver
Born
May 17, 1866,

Died
Nov. 29, 1906.

On the side, a piece of the "bark" is peeled back to reveal "Mono Camp No. 1240."
